WebIn the slope formula, the slope (m) is equal to rise over run: m = rise / run = (y₂ - y₁) / (x₂ - x₁) Let's say we are given a line with points (4, 2) and (6, 1). If we say that point 1 is (4, 2) and point 2 is (6, 1), then: x₁ = 4 and x₂ = 6 … WebRise = Run / Gradient Rise = 5m / 15 Convert the units: Rise = 5,000mm / 15 Rise = 333mm How to work out the run We want to work out the run of a ramp that has a rise of 166mm and a gradient of 1:12.
